Course Summary
This manual provides technical specifications and guidance for sutveying and mapping with the NAVSTAR Global Positioning Syatem(GPS). It is intended for use by engineering, planning, operations, ral estate and constriction personel performing georeferenced feature mapping or accurate control surveys for civil works and military construction projects. Procedural and quality control standards are defined to establish Corps-wide uniformity in the use of GPS by hired-labor personnel, construction contractors, and Architect-Engineer (A-E) contractors.
Learning Objectives
- Operational theory
- GPS Reference systems
- GPS absolute positioning determination concepts, errors and accuracies
- Differential or relative positioning determination concepts
- GPS applications in USACE
- GPS receiver and equipment selection
- Planning data collection with GPS
- Conducting GPS field surveys
- Post processing differential GPS observational data
- Adjustment of GPS surveys
- Contracting GPS surveying services
